Position Purpose
Designers will work as part of a project team to deliver a variety of stream, wetland, and buffer restoration projects for both public and private clients across the Southeast. This work will include but is not limited to geomorphic assessments, stream and wetland restoration design, permitting, construction observation, and post-construction monitoring.
Essential Functions + Responsibilities
- Assist in conducting geomorphic assessments (cross section and longitudinal profile survey, pebble counts, and BEHI analysis, etc.)
- Design, analysis, and permitting for stream and wetland restoration projects
- Develop technical memos and mitigation plans
- Delineate drainage areas and use AutoCAD or ArcGIS to develop drainage area maps
- Complete Hydrograph routing, Riverine Modeling, FEMA Flood Studies, CLOMR/LOMR letters, and No-Rise certifications
- Complete analyses of open channel systems
- Work in accordance with company standards with project team from concept phase through construction administration for a variety of projects
- Assist with annual monitoring activities of constructed projects and preparation of annual monitoring reports.
- Be willing to perform field work as necessary for geomorphic assessments, construction observation, and monitoring activities
